Abstract

Myopsalta atrata (Goding & Froggatt) is redescribed in light of recently collected specimens that match the original type material. New evidence shows that M. atrata is restricted to the Hawkesbury Sandstone region, specifically in the vicinity of Greater Sydney in New South Wales, Australia. Two new species of Myopsalta are described from central western New South Wales: Myopsalta libritor sp.nov. and M. coolahensis sp.nov. Both occur in grassland, typically in association with alluvial terraces. In addition to morphological redescription, the species-specific calling song for each taxon is documented here for the first time.
